Canned peas, carrots, and corn are popular pantry preserves. Once opened and not completely used up, the canned vegetables often end up in the refrigerator. However, cans that have just been opened should not be stored there.

Food cans: Opened do not put them in the refrigerator

If opened canned goods are stored in the refrigerator, the tin present in the can accumulates in the food inside. This happens especially with acidic content such as tomatoes and fruit.

However, canned mushrooms are also affected by the process in which the food reacts with the tin of the metal can after opening due to the oxygen. This reaction can change the taste of the food. Large amounts of tin in the body can also put an unnecessary strain on the kidneys and lead to stomach irritation.

Decant canned goods

To avoid a reaction with tin, canned food should always be transferred to porcelain or plastic container with a lid and then placed in the refrigerator. This keeps fruit and vegetables fresh for another two to three days. Unopened and in the undamaged original condition, the contents of the can have a shelf life of around one year if the canned food has been stored in the dark and below 20 degrees Celsius.

The refrigerator is often responsible for high power consumption. With a high-quality device, you can save a lot of energy in the long term and reduce CO2 emissions. But when is a new device due?

The electricity consumption of refrigerators and freezers

There is a perception that a refrigerator needs a new model every 10 to 15 years. But that’s not necessarily true. If the old refrigerator is an energy-saving model, it can still have acceptable consumption values ​​today – especially if you operate it in a cool location.

In any case, it is advisable to get to the bottom of the energy consumption with a power meter. Basically, modern, efficient compressors get by with significantly less energy than the old devices. This is confirmed by a short study on the electricity efficiency of old and new refrigerators and freezers carried out by the Freiburg-based consulting company Ö-quadrat on behalf of the North Rhine-Westphalia consumer advice centre. A total of 1069 devices, 884 of which were free-standing and 185 built-in, were tested.

The results of the study are unequivocal: the power consumption of refrigerators has fallen continuously since the early 1990s. Here is the comparison: around 30 years ago, a standard refrigerator with a freezer compartment consumed 410 kilowatt hours (kWh) per year. The average consumption of a new appliance today is only around 40 percent of that and is around 170 kWh per refrigerator. The other types of appliances, such as refrigerators without a freezer compartment and large fridge-freezer combinations, also show significantly lower power consumption in new appliances. Information on how to select the right cooling device and how to use it is provided by the NRW consumer advice center.

Device type, location and temperature setting are crucial to save costs and energy

A model calculation by shows exactly the difference: the price of a kWh is just under 42 cents today, compared to just 30 cents in 1990. In 1990, a refrigerator cost 123 euros in electricity per year. The same device with the same consumption in 2022 is 172.20 euros. What is not taken into account is that the power consumption of cooling devices increases significantly over the years. This is mainly due to the aging of the insulation material. With older devices, defects such as leaking doors or heavily dusty cooling grids can also lead to increased consumption. The age-related additional consumption is estimated at around one percent per year of life. With the recommended measuring device you can check the power consumption and decide whether it is worth buying a new device.

The advice from energy expert Gerhild Loer from the consumer advice center in North Rhine-Westphalia is clear: “If you have a refrigerator with a freezer compartment as a free-standing appliance, replacing it after around 15 years is worthwhile. For built-in devices, this only applies from the age of 20, due to the higher acquisition costs”.

She has even more tips up her sleeve to save electricity when operating a refrigerator. The temperature setting is seven degrees Celsius for the refrigerator and minus 18 degrees Celsius for the freezer. “The location of the device must also be taken into account. The less sunlight falls on the refrigerator, the less the cooling unit has to work. This saves electricity in the long term and efficiently extends the performance of cooling devices,” explains Loer.

Defrosting the fridge is not that difficult. We offer you many useful tips and a guide that will get the job done quickly.

The fridge needs to be defrosted regularly to keep it working properly. Electricity costs also increase if cleaning is not carried out. We would therefore like to show you a few tips on how to defrost the refrigerator, clean it quickly and keep it clean.

Always defrost the refrigerator quickly

It is important to defrost the refrigerator quickly. Because the food has to be cooled again quickly. Most of the time, the refrigerator is also connected to the freezer, so that the frozen food could thaw there when it is switched off. Therefore, action must be taken quickly. Incidentally, the most important reason for defrosting the refrigerator is that energy costs increase when there is a lot of ice.

Regular defrosting is important in order not to have any energy guzzlers in the house. The food from the fridge can easily be on the table for an hour, after all, when you go shopping, you don’t have the opportunity to put the food in the fridge immediately. If you also want to defrost your freezer, you have to think better. Neighbors with space in the freezer could help here. Otherwise, in winter, you can put things outside to keep them cold and frozen.

Quickly clean the fridge

The refrigerator can be cleaned with warm water and washing-up liquid. Simply wash, dry, and put away. All glass panes, fruit trays, and more can basically be put in the dishwasher. If the fridge smells bad, you no longer have to clean it, but instead, use a solution of lemon washing-up liquid. That means you prepare water with washing-up liquid and add citric acid. The bad smell is masked and the refrigerator shines like new after cleaning.

But even after cleaning, the citric acid can be placed in the refrigerator. The liquid is in a cup of slices of lemon is on a plate. So the fridge smells like pure summer.

Defrost hot water in the refrigerator when there is a lot of ice

If the fridge is very iced up, simply place a pot of hot water in the unit. The same goes for the freezer too. Some people also like to use the hairdryer to make ice removal easier. If you do this, you save long waiting times and can put the food in the fridge faster.

The condensation water must of course be collected, this can be done with towels that you simply put in the bottom of the fridge or with dishcloths. The fat pan from the oven is also a great help.

Vinegar disinfects the refrigerator

If you feel like you have to disinfect the refrigerator, you should use vinegar. Simply mix warm water with vinegar and not only unpleasant smells are gone. Vinegar essence is not recommended here, it smells far too strong and of course, the smell also spreads to the food in the refrigerator.
